## Deployment: Date Localization

Quick note for the sync. The Fennelwick storefront now localizes date formats at render time instead of in the API layer. Locale detection falls back to the tenant default if the request header is missing. Rollout is behind a flag, on for staging, off for prod until Thursday. No schema changes. Caching keys include the locale, so expect a one-time cache miss spike. Deploy uses the standard pipeline with the settings listed below.

config for yajep-tafof:
[rusath]
team = julmir
access_code = ac_fe37fd
host = rusath.novactech.test
port = 8000
owner = pelmir.weneth
peer = oliwyn.olvarqdyn.internal

## Pondside Environments: websocket reconnect bug

Heads up for the security review: our staging tier of Pondside has a reconnect loop where the websocket client retries with the original (possibly expired) auth token. Prod is patched; staging isn't yet, so you may see noisy auth failures in the traces. Worth eyeballing the backoff logic too. Staging currently runs with the following configuration values.

service settings:
[silwyn]
host = silwyn.crelvogrid.internal
user = silwyn_svc
database = silwyn_prod

# Crash-report pipeline settings (Fernwick mobile)
# Reports are scrubbed on-device before upload: stack frames only,
# no user text, no screenshots. The ingest worker validates the
# payload signature, drops anything over 2 MB, and batches inserts
# every 30 seconds. Retention is 90 days, enforced by a nightly
# sweep job. Security note: symbols are resolved server-side so
# raw addresses never leave the ingest tier. Batched reports are
# written to the triage database using the connection string below.

primary connection of yagep-kahip = redis://giliel_svc:zYiKsLL2PLpfPL@db-348f.xolmarsys.corp:5432/fenwyn